This study is a randomized, double-blind, placebo controlled trial designed to confirm the symptomatic effects of camicinal treatment vs. placebo, on gastroparesis symptoms in type 1 and 2 diabetic subjects with gastroparesis. The primary purpose of this study is to determine if a low-dose of camicinal (25 milligram\[mg\]) for 12 weeks of repeat administration improves gastroparesis symptoms as measured by the Gastrointestinal Cardinal Symptom Index - Daily Diary (GCSI-DD) in approximately 120 subjects with type 1 or 2 diabetes mellitus (DM) who have documented abnormally slow gastric emptying and have symptoms consistent with gastroparesis. Subjects will be randomized in a 1:1 ratio to receive either camicinal or placebo. The study will consist of a screening/baseline period of up to 35 days, a 12 week treatment period, a 2-week post-treatment assessment of symptoms and a 14 day (+/- 2 days) post treatment safety follow-up visit.

Eltrombopag olamine (SB-497115-GR) is an orally bioavailable, small molecule thrombopoietin receptor agonist that may be beneficial in medical disorders associated with thrombocytopenia. Eltrombopag has been shown to increase platelet counts in patients with thrombocytopenia from various etiologies (Idiopathic thrombocytopenic purpura \[ITP\], liver disease, aplastic anemia and chemotherapy induced thrombocytopenia). Approximately 350 subjects will be randomized in a 1:1 ratio (175 into the eltrombopag arm and 175 into the placebo arm). Approximately 55 subjects will be enrolled into the azacitidine. Subjects with intermediate-1, intermediate-2 or high risk MDS by IPSS, and baseline platelet count of \<75 Giga (10\^9) per liter (Gi/L) will only be enrolled. This is a randomized, double-blind, parallel group, placebo-controlled study designed to explore the platelet supportive care effects of eltrombopag versus placebo in combination with the standard of care hypomethylating agent, azacitidine. The primary objective of this study is to determine the effect of eltrombopag versus placebo on the proportion of subjects who are platelet transfusion free during the first 4 cycles of azacitidine therapy. Key secondary endpoints include overall survival, disease response, and disease progression.

Community ambulation is a highly complex skill requiring the ability to adapt to increased environmental complexity and perform multiple tasks simultaneously. Deficits in dual-tasking may severely compromise the ability to participate fully in community living. Unfortunately, current rehabilitation practice for stroke fails to adequately address dual-task limitations; individuals with stroke continue to exhibit clinically significant dual-task costs on gait at discharge. As a result, many stroke survivors are living in the community with residual deficits that may increase disability in the real world and lead to falls with devastating consequences. To address this issue, the proposed study investigates the efficacy of dual-task gait training on attention allocation and locomotor performance in community-dwelling stroke survivors. Because walking in the real world often requires time-critical tasks and obstacle avoidance, the investigators will test the impact of dual-task gait training on cognitive-motor interference during walking at preferred speed and at maximal speed (Aim 1), and on locomotor control during obstacle negotiation (Aim 2). The investigators will also evaluate the effects of the intervention on community reintegration and participation (Aim 3).

The rationale underlying the study is that donor site bleeding is common and often problematic when presenting to the burn surgeon or staff. Frequently, gauze wound dressings are not sufficiently hemostatic to control a donor site bleed thereby leading to administration of vasoconstrictive agents and repeated application of wound dressing/pressure. The hemostatic textile Stasilon™ has proven superior to gauze in reducing bleeding from anesthetized pigs undergoing standardized surgically-induced trauma. Also, observational case reports have noted cessation of bleeding in a limited number of human patients with difficult to control bleeds.

Loss-of-function mutation of the gene encoding the CYP450 2C19 enzyme has emerged as a likely determinant of resistance to clopidogrel therapy. The primary hypothesis of the proposed research is that among patients with confirmed loss-of-function alleles of the CYP2C19 gene, increasing the maintenance clopidogrel dose from 75 to 150 mg will result in significant reduction in the rate of measured clopidogrel resistance defined by multiple measures of platelet function

Growing evidence over recent years supports a potential role for low grade chronic inflammation in the pathogenesis of insulin resistance and type 2 diabetes. In this study we will determine whether salsalate, a member of the commonly used Non-Steroidal Anti-Inflammatory Drug (NSAID) class, is effective in lowering sugars in patients with type 2 diabetes. The study will determine whether salicylates represent a new pharmacological option for diabetes management. The study is conducted in two stages. Enrollment in the first stage is complete. The primary objective of the first stage was to select a dose of salsalate that is both well-tolerated and demonstrates a trend toward improvement in glycemic control. The primary objective of Stage 2 of the study is to evaluate the effects of salsalate on blood sugar control in diabetes; the tolerability of salsalate use in patients with type 2 diabetes (T2D); and the effects of salsalate on measures of inflammation, the metabolic syndrome, and cardiac risk.

This phase I/II trial (phase I closed to accrual as of 09/29/2009) is studying the side effects and best dose of bortezomib, paclitaxel, and carboplatin when given with radiation therapy and to see how well they work in treating patients with stage IIIA or stage IIIB non-small cell lung cancer that cannot be removed by surgery. Bortezomib may stop the growth of tumor cells by blocking the enzymes necessary for their growth. Drugs used in chemotherapy, such as paclitaxel and carboplatin, work in different ways to stop tumor cells from dividing so they stop growing or die. Bortezomib may increase the effectiveness of paclitaxel and carboplatin by making tumor cells more sensitive to the drugs. Radiation therapy uses high-energy x-rays to damage tumor cells. Giving bortezomib, paclitaxel, and carboplatin together with radiation therapy may kill more tumor cells.

RATIONALE: Drugs used in chemotherapy, such as cyclophosphamide and dexamethasone, work in different ways to stop the growth of cancer cells, either by killing the cells or by stopping them from dividing. Carfilzomib may stop the growth of cancer cells by blocking some of the enzymes needed for cell growth. Thalidomide may stop the growth of cancer cells by blocking blood flow to the tumor. Giving combination chemotherapy together with carfilzomib and thalidomide may kill more cancer cells. PURPOSE: This phase I/II trial is studying the side effects and best dose of carfilzomib when given together with cyclophosphamide, thalidomide, and dexamethasone in treating patients with newly diagnosed active multiple myeloma.

Recent reports have identified a specific oncogenic mutation L265P of the MYD88 gene in approximately 30% of the patients with the activated B-cell (ABC) type of Diffuse Large B Cell Lymphoma (DLBCL). MYD88 is an initial adapter linker protein in the signaling pathway of the Toll Like Receptors (TLRs), including the endosomal TLRs 7, 8, and 9, for which the ligands are nucleic acids. IMO-8400 is an oligonucleotide specifically designed to inhibit ligand activation of TLRs 7,8, and 9. Recent studies indicate that in the presence of L265P mutation ligand activation of those TLRs results in markedly increased signaling with subsequent increased cell activation, cell survival, and cell proliferation. The scientific rationale for assessing the use of IMO-8400 to treat patients with DLBCL and the L265P mutation is based on laboratory observations that IMO-8400 inhibits ligand-based activation of cells with the mutation and decreases the survival and proliferation of the cell populations responsible for the propagation of the disease.

The prevalence of patent foramen ovale (PFO) is about 25% in the general population and approximately 40% in patients who have ischemic stroke of unknown cause (cryptogenic stroke). Given the large number of asymptomatic patients, no primary prevention is currently recommended. On the contrary, secondary prevention is very important. Prospective studies have shown that antithrombotic treatment (ATT) with aspirin or warfarin appears to negate the risk of recurrent stroke associated with a PFO. Patients with spontaneous or large right-to-left shunts (RLS), those with a coinciding atrial septal aneurysm (ASA) or multiple ischemic events prior to the PFO diagnosis may still be at increased risk of stroke recurrence despite ATT. Percutaneous device closure (PDC) is a challenging alternative to ATT. Several studies reported 0% to 3.4% annual recurrence rates of stroke or TIA in patients treated by PDC. To date, there is no data from randomized controlled trials (RCT) comparing the risk of stroke recurrence after PDC with that under ATT only. The results from ongoing RCTs are not to be awaited in the near future, mainly due to low enrolment and event rates. Alternative data-gathering strategies such as multicenter registries are needed to overcome the low recruitment rates. The aim of the present study is to compare the risk of recurrent stroke and TIA in patients with PFO and otherwise unexplained stroke who undergo PDC or receive ATT.

GSK2336805 is a hepatitis C virus (HCV) NS5A inhibitor being developed for the treatment of chronic hepatitis C (CHC). This study will assess the safety, antiviral activity, and pharmacokinetics of GSK2336805 alone and in combination with peginterferon alfa 2a and ribavirin in subjects with chronic hepatitis C (CHC).
